Reports Trigger Political Speculation

The controversy began after media outlets reported that Iran president Masoud resign and had submitted a formal resignation letter to the office of Supreme Leader Mojtaba Khamenei.

According to those reports, Pezeshkian allegedly argued that the elected government was being sidelined from crucial decision-making processes. The reports further suggested that the IRGC had gained significant influence over major state affairs, limiting the government’s ability to function effectively.

These claims immediately generated widespread reactions among political analysts, diplomats, and international observers who closely follow developments inside Iran.

Iranian Government Denies the Claims

Shortly after the reports surfaced, Iranian officials strongly rejected the allegations.

Officials from the president’s office publicly stated that the resignation rumors were false and described them as misinformation spread by foreign media organizations. Government representatives emphasized that President Pezeshkian continues to carry out his responsibilities and remains committed to serving the Iranian people.

Even though reports suggested that Iran president Masoud resign, official statements from Tehran insisted that no such resignation had occurred.

This contradiction between media reports and government denials has created uncertainty regarding the actual situation within Iran’s political establishment.

Who Is Masoud Pezeshkian?

Masoud Pezeshkian emerged as a significant political figure after winning Iran’s presidential election as a reformist candidate.

He campaigned on promises of improving economic conditions, reducing international isolation, and pursuing a more pragmatic approach toward diplomacy. His election was viewed by many voters as a sign of public demand for moderation and reform.

When reports claimed that Iran president Masoud resign, many supporters expressed concern about what such a development could mean for reformist politics in Iran.

Pezeshkian’s presidency was seen as an attempt to balance public demands for change with the realities of Iran’s complex political structure.

Internal Power Struggles in Tehran

Iran’s political system is unique because power is distributed among multiple institutions.

The president oversees many administrative functions, but ultimate authority rests with the Supreme Leader and several powerful state bodies. This structure sometimes creates tensions between elected officials and unelected institutions.

Reports alleging that Iran president Masoud resign suggested frustration over limitations placed on the civilian government’s authority.

Observers note that disagreements between different centers of power have periodically emerged throughout Iran’s modern political history.
